
CCTV footage captured the "white shirt man" causing a disturbance in a restaurant, kicking tables and smashing glasses, claiming the reason was "the fried rice was not tasty."
In this case, a Facebook user posted a CCTV clip showing a man wearing a white shirt and black hat causing a disturbance inside a restaurant, knocking over light fixtures, breaking glasses, and kicking tables. An employee was injured by shards of glass. The incident occurred at 00:33 on 9 March 2026 at a restaurant located in Soi 13, Makham Khu Subdistrict, Nikhom Phatthana District, Rayong Province.
On 11 March 2026, reporters visited the scene and met Ms. Cha Yen, 41, the restaurant owner, who showed the damaged areas seen in the clip. She revealed that the man, identified as LGBT, gave the reason for his outburst as the restaurant’s fried rice being tasteless. The restaurant is willing to address the issue, but the man has no right to cause destruction. As the owner, she must take legal action to protect employees and deter future incidents.
Meanwhile, Ms. Ann, 21, a restaurant employee, said the incident started when the customer ordered fried rice and criticized its taste. The customer then called the server over to taste it, tipping the server to coax them into saying the fried rice was bad. The staff called the owner, who spoke with the customer by phone and accepted the criticism, promising improvement and asking the customer to lower their voice. When the customer remained dissatisfied, the disturbance occurred as shown in the clip. Ms. Ann was injured by glass shards on her arm. After the incident, the customer left 2,000 baht.
However, this information is from the victim’s side only. Further details from the other party are awaited. Updates will be provided as the situation develops.
